Our Methodology
When determining the value of a school in our Best Doctor's Degree Colleges for the Money (Income $48-$75k) in Minnesota ranking, we first look at its average net price of a student coming from a family that makes $48-$75k a year. The net price is defined as the sum of room and board, tuition, and fees minus any financial aid that the student receives.
But, a school that excels in providing value for your money must also be a great school overall as well.
To take this into account we consider a college's overall Best Colleges ranking which itself looks at a combination of different factors like degree completion, educational resources, student body caliber and post-graduation earnings for the school as a whole.
